Is it possible to make a wifi card work through mSATA-USB adapter?
If yes then how? I haven't had any luck, the OS recognizes the adapter's controller but nothing more.
I doubt it. That mSATA to USB adapter is likely built specifically for mSATA only and doesn't handle mPCIe signalling at all.
